WebMar 15, 2024 · In the upper-right corner of any page, click your profile photo, then click Settings. In the left sidebar, click Developer settings . In the left sidebar, click Personal access tokens . Click Generate new token . Give your token a descriptive name. To give your token an expiration, select the Expiration drop-down menu, then click a default or ... WebJul 5, 2024 · If the operation allowed not being logged in, gh repo clone would result in a "repository not found" error message, which would be misleading because the private repository might exist and the user just needs to be logged in to access it. If the repository to clone is a fork, gh repo clone will set up an additional "upstream" git remote.
WebNov 10, 2024 · Git Command Line. From the Git menu on the menu bar, choose Clone Repository to open the Clone a repository window. In the Clone a repository window, enter the clone URL of the remote Git repo that you want to clone, verify the local folder path where you want to create the local clone, and then choose Clone.

WebGitHub recommends that you use fine-grained personal access tokens instead, which you can restrict to specific repositories. Fine-grained personal access tokens also enable you to specify fine-grained permissions instead of broad scopes.
